Output 23ec23b06f010ce146caaa218557f5d707fb4e95b1bbbe752f868561df7a54d4:0

value
206818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 041020dd2b6842936cec9150394d60e1cd40967b OP_EQUAL
address
324VwvuT2SWLEGdusEimQ417SUXkXsnRjM
transaction
23ec23b06f010ce146caaa218557f5d707fb4e95b1bbbe752f868561df7a54d4